Description
Technical field
The utility model embodiment is related to field of textile machinery, specifically a kind of loom framework height adjuster.
Background technique
For existing weaving loom since its self weight is larger, rack is essentially stationary structure, leads to the height of loom framework
Degree can not be adjusted, and cause inconvenience to staff.And water-jet loom has eccentric tightening weft axis, including tightening weft axis
Axis body, swinging shaft, the first reed foot and counter weight device, the tightening weft axis axis body are connect with swinging shaft by shaft coupling, and described
One reed foot is fixed on tightening weft axis axis body by the first bolt, the counter weight device include integrally casting shaping the second reed foot and
Clump weight, the clump weight are fixed on tightening weft axis axis body by end cap.Reed foot and eccentricity balance-weight block integrally casting shaping are realized
The rigid connection of clump weight and tightening weft axis can generate larger vibration in loom operation, the Mechanical Structure Strength requirement to rack
It is higher.Because of some loom frameworks that can adjust bracket height of the invention, general settling mode is by the supporting leg of rack
It is arranged to the supporting leg with hydraulic mechanism, so that leg length is adjusted by hydraulic mechanism, but this mode obviously can
Structure complexity is caused to be substantially improved, especially hydraulic mechanism needs hydraulic system to provide power, and increases manufacturing cost.
Therefore, bracket height and low-cost loom framework height can be adjusted by specific structure by needing one kind
Degree adjustment device.
Utility model content
The utility model embodiment, which provides, a kind of can adjust bracket height and low in cost by specific structure
Loom framework height adjuster to solve the defect of the above-mentioned prior art.

Specific embodiment
In order to make those skilled in the art more fully understand the technical solution in the utility model, below in conjunction with this reality
With the attached drawing in new embodiment, the technical scheme in the utility model embodiment is clearly and completely described, it is clear that
The described embodiments are only a part of the embodiments of the utility model, instead of all the embodiments.Based on the utility model
In embodiment, every other implementation obtained by those of ordinary skill in the art without making creative efforts
The range of the utility model protection all should belong in example.
It please refers to shown in attached drawing 1-3, Fig. 1 is loom framework height adjuster provided by the embodiment of the utility model
Structural schematic diagram.The loom framework height adjuster of the utility model embodiment include two opposition setting panel 11 with
And four crossbeams 12, described two panels 11 are connected by crossbeam 12, the panel includes big plate 13, middle plate 14, height adjustment
Device 15, the height adjuster 15 are respectively arranged at 14 bottom of the big plate 13 and middle plate, the height adjuster packet
Installation sleeve 1 is included, the outer sleeve 2 of 1 lower section of installation sleeve is set to by plane bearing 10, the outer sleeve 2 is provided with
Internal screw thread, and be spirally connected with externally threaded inner sleeve 3 is provided with, 3 top interior of the inner sleeve is fixedly installed jacking block 4, institute
It states and is provided with pedestal 5 below inner sleeve 3, lower jacking block 6, the upper jacking block 4 and the lower jacking block 6 are provided at the top of the pedestal 5
Between be provided with spring 7, the spring 7 can stretch out in a free state from 3 bottom end of inner sleeve.
Further, it in order to make the length of inner sleeve 3 be utilized effectively, avoids wasting, the length of the outer sleeve 2
Degree is greater than the length that the inner sleeve 3 has male thread portion.
Further, it can prevent rotation from excessively outer sleeve 2 being caused to connect with pedestal 5 in rotating jacket cylinder 2 to reach
Touching causes entire rack and weaving loom total amount all to be undertaken by outer sleeve 2 and inner sleeve 3, causes to deform, 3 bottom end of inner sleeve
Outer rim is provided with positive stop lug boss 8.
Further, the outer sleeve 2 is provided with the handle 9 for turn, can only be led to by the leverage of handle 9
Cross the rotation that manpower realizes outer sleeve 2.
In the utility model embodiment, inner sleeve 3 can effectively be shared by the setting of spring 7 and outer sleeve 2 is held
The weight received, and in weaving loom operation, spring 7 can also effectively have the function that shock-absorption noise-reduction.
In above-mentioned specific embodiment, big plate 13 may be sized to high 900mm, wide 1340mm, thick 140mm, and
And big plate 13 and middle plate 14 can be made by way of integrally casting respectively.
In conclusion the spacing that the utility model embodiment changes with inner sleeve 3 by rotating jacket cylinder 2 makes
Bracket height is adjusted, and can effectively reduce friction by the setting of plane bearing 10 to reduce rotating jacket cylinder 2
Required power, reaching only can be completed by manpower, and overall structure is simple, and manufacturing cost is relatively low.
